Hi a bit of info I first had urinary infection in feb 2019 so I had antibiotics and at same time GP did a psa test that come back high so within a couple of weeks I had an mri scan that showed abnormal area in prostate so by August I had a trus 18 core biopsy that come back negative. 
They said they would just keep on eye on my psa, with the pandemic in 2020 nothing happened they said my psa was still high so put me on the list for biopsy again but said the wait might be 6 months. 
By June 2021 I was offered another mri and from

that they said there were changes at it was rads4 and still needed a biopsy which I did not get until fed 2022 but this time it was a targeted biopsy but again come back negative.

The advice was I needed a template biopsy because of the rads4 mri I my mind I’ve already excepted I’ve got prostate cancer because of this. I finally got the template biopsy 13th September 2022 they said they would take about 50 cores and map out the prostate, from this I had water retention and needed a catheter for 2 weeks. From that biopsy they said I would have results in 2 to 3 weeks but it’s 3 and a half weeks and still nothing just an appointment for a flow test that they said I would have to follow up catheter being removed, is this normal to wait this long it’s like I’ve been forgotten.
